What this inspection record means

O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

Section 5(a)(1) of the Occupational Safety and Health Act of 1970:  The
employer did not furnish employment
and a place of employment which were free from recognized hazards that
were causing or likely to cause
death or serious physical harm to employees in that employees were exposed
to crushing injuries in that:
(A)  The employer allowed an employee lift attachment which affected the
capacity and safe operation of a
Hyster 30 fork truck without the manufacturer's written approval.
(B)  The Hyster 30 fork truck was not marked to identify the attachment,
show the approximate weight of the
truck and attachment combination, and show the capacity of the truck with
attachment at maximum elevation
with load centered.
TOOL ROOM/MAINTENANCE:  THE HYSTER 30 FORK TRUCK, SER 8010B0303SF WAS USED
WITH A "HOMEMADE" EMPLOYEE LIFTING ATTACHMENT TO ACCESS CEILING LIGHTING
WITHOUT THE MANUFACTURER'S WRITTEN APPROVAL AND WAS NOT MARKED TO
IDENTIFY THE ATTACHMENT AND VARIOUS WEIGHT COMBINATIONS.S
